Thank you

You are amazing!

Out contact details:

+44 (0) 203 3030 683

Email: [Please enable javascript to see this email address]

Treehouse Innovation, Studio 33, RIVERSIDE BUILDING, 55 Trinity Buoy Wharf, London E14 0FP

Let's talk

If you can spare the time for a 30 min ZOOM call, a member of our senior team would be happy to discuss your aspirations and challenges, and explain how we can help.

Send us a message

Please enter your name

We use HubSpot as our CRM platform. By submitting this form, you acknowledge that your information will be transferred to HubSpot for processing. Learn more about HubSpot's privacy practices here.